Cypress, TX Apartments for Rent

Cypress sits along U.S. 290 about 24 miles northwest of Downtown Houston, with quick links to TX-99 for crosstown trips. If you're looking for apartments for rent in Cypress, you'll find convenient access to major job hubs-Downtown via U.S. 290, the Energy Corridor via TX-99 to I-10, and The Woodlands via TX-99 to I-45. Weekends are easy to fill at Houston Premium Outlets, the waterfront Boardwalk at Towne Lake, BlackHorse Golf Club, and trails at Little Cypress Creek Preserve and Telge Park, plus local history at Cypress Top Historic Park.

Popular places to live include Bridgeland (lakes, miles of trails, and shops at Lakeland Village Center), Towne Lake (waterfront rentals near the Boardwalk), Fairfield (established streets close to Fairfield Town Center and U.S. 290), Coles Crossing (tree-lined paths near Telge Park), Cypress Creek Lakes (community lakes with quick access to Cypress Towne Center), BlackHorse Ranch (next to BlackHorse Golf Club), Longwood Village (close to Longwood Golf Club and Grant/Louetta), and Miramesa at Canyon Lakes West with easy reach to TX-99. Shoppers can look for apartments near Houston Premium Outlets or rentals close to U.S. 290 to keep commutes and errands simple, with dining and entertainment clustered along Barker Cypress, Fry, and Spring Cypress.
